
Contratos Inteligentes: Automatizando Acordos no Blockchain
Os contratos inteligentes, ou smart contracts, estão transformando como entendemos e implementamos acordos, automatizando processos e eliminando intermediários através da tecnologia blockchain. Com potencial para impactar setores diversos como saúde, seguros e governo, os smart contracts prometem maior eficiência e transparência.
Mariana Santos
26/11/2024 - 7 meses atrás

Entendendo os Contratos Inteligentes
Os contratos inteligentes, ou smart contracts, são uma inovação fascinante que vem ganhando espaço no mundo digital. Eles funcionam como programas de computador que executam ações automaticamente quando determinadas condições são atendidas. Isso significa que, diferente dos contratos tradicionais, que dependem de intermediários para serem cumpridos, os contratos inteligentes garantem que os acordos sejam realizados de forma automática e segura.
Imagine um contrato de aluguel, por exemplo. Com um smart contract, o pagamento do aluguel poderia ser processado automaticamente todos os meses, sem a necessidade de intervenção humana. Se o pagamento não for realizado dentro do prazo, o contrato poderia acionar uma cláusula que impede o acesso ao imóvel. Isso elimina a necessidade de advogados ou agentes imobiliários, tornando o processo mais rápido e menos suscetível a erros.
A ideia de contratos inteligentes foi inicialmente proposta por Nick Szabo, um cientista da computação, em 1994. Ele descreveu esses contratos como protocolos de transação computadorizados que executam os termos de um contrato. Com o advento das tecnologias de blockchain, como a Ethereum, a visão de Szabo começou a se tornar realidade, oferecendo um ambiente seguro e transparente para a execução de contratos.
Funcionamento dos Contratos Inteligentes no Blockchain
Os contratos inteligentes são armazenados no blockchain, uma tecnologia de registro descentralizado. Isso significa que uma vez que um contrato é criado, ele é imutável e pode ser acessado por qualquer pessoa na rede. Isso garante transparência, pois todos os participantes podem verificar as condições e resultados do contrato sem a necessidade de confiar em um único intermediário.
Blockchain funciona como um livro-razão público onde todas as transações são registradas. Cada bloco contém várias transações e uma vez que é adicionado à cadeia, não pode ser alterado. Isso torna o sistema altamente seguro e resistente a fraudes. Os contratos inteligentes aproveitam essa segurança inata do blockchain para garantir que seus termos sejam cumpridos exatamente como foram programados.
Além disso, o uso de contratos inteligentes no blockchain elimina a possibilidade de manipulação ou censura. Cada nodo da rede possui uma cópia do blockchain, tornando impossível para qualquer entidade única modificar ou apagar dados sem o consenso da maioria. Isso é crucial para garantir que os contratos sejam cumpridos de maneira justa e transparente.
Vantagens e Desafios dos Contratos Inteligentes
Uma das principais vantagens dos contratos inteligentes é a automação de processos. Ao eliminar intermediários, eles reduzem significativamente os custos e o tempo necessários para a execução de um contrato. Isso é especialmente benéfico em setores como finanças, onde transações rápidas e seguras são essenciais para o funcionamento do mercado.
No entanto, os contratos inteligentes também apresentam desafios. Como são baseados em código, qualquer erro de programação pode levar a consequências indesejadas. Além disso, a imutabilidade do blockchain significa que, uma vez implantado, um contrato inteligente não pode ser facilmente alterado ou corrigido. Isso requer uma atenção redobrada na fase de desenvolvimento para evitar falhas.
Outra preocupação é a regulamentação. A natureza descentralizada dos contratos inteligentes torna difícil para os governos aplicar leis e regulamentos tradicionais. Isso pode criar incertezas legais, especialmente em casos de disputas contratuais. Portanto, é crucial que desenvolvedores e usuários compreendam os riscos e as responsabilidades envolvidas no uso dessa tecnologia.
Impacto dos Contratos Inteligentes na Sociedade
Os contratos inteligentes têm o potencial de transformar vários setores da sociedade. Na área de saúde, por exemplo, eles podem garantir que os dados dos pacientes sejam compartilhados de maneira segura e apenas com as partes autorizadas. Isso poderia melhorar significativamente a eficiência e a segurança no tratamento de pacientes.
Na indústria de seguros, os contratos inteligentes podem automatizar o processo de reivindicações, pagando automaticamente os segurados assim que as condições estipuladas forem atendidas. Isso não só agiliza o processo, mas também reduz a possibilidade de fraudes, já que todas as transações são registradas no blockchain.
Por fim, no setor público, contratos inteligentes poderiam aumentar a transparência e a eficiência nos processos governamentais. Desde a distribuição de benefícios sociais até a realização de eleições, essa tecnologia pode garantir que os recursos sejam alocados de forma justa e que os processos sejam conduzidos de forma transparente, aumentando a confiança pública nas instituições.